Duties

Help

Drives one or more types of passenger buses which 16+ passengers. Drives predetermined and/or scheduled routes or special runs on and off the installation, such as touring trips to historic locations and recreation events/facilities. Reads maps and judges road/traffic conditions to determine the shortest and safest route. Provides friendly, polite, and courteous service. Enforces passenger seatbelt use. May check I.D. cards to ensure authorization of passengers as required.

Performs operator maintenance, such as checking fluid levels and air pressure in tires, cleaning and washing of vehicles and performing inspection checklists to ensure safe and proper operation. Transport vehicles off installation and coordinate repairs with private companies.

Maintains records and documents actions on operator inspection checklists/forms and accident/incident reports. Uses two-way radio (or other device) to maintain communications with dispatcher/supervisor on assignments and locations.

Utilizes safety practices and procedures following established safety rules and regulations and maintains a safe and clean work environment. Uses and assures proper fit of required safety equipment and clothing.

Loads and unloads heavy boxes, bulky supplies, and materials to and from trucks, dollies, etc., moves heavy boxes, cartons, luggage by hand, hand truck, or dolly. Opens crates and boxes using crowbars, and bands using shears. Stacks boxes and cartons where directed.

Using a shovel, hand tamps, rakes, and drivable equipment to loosen dirt, fill holes, and level bumps/low places to mitigate program safety concerns. Assists with a variety of field maintenance tasks to include, rolling, aerating, seeding, weeding and chalking.

Operates hand lawnmowers and riding lawn maintenance equipment; clears small trees and bushes, using handsaws, hatchets, clippers, and small brush clearing machines.

Assembles, moves, and arranges furniture as directed. Executes minor facility modifications in accordance with Child and Youth Program regulations (i.e. installation of finger guards). Clears snow from sidewalks and points of emergency egress using snowblowers, plows, shovels, and ice clearing equipment. Performs full range of facility manager functions to include keeping outside of building clean of trash and paper, changing light bulbs, and performing minor facility maintenance. Cleans parking lot and entryway as necessary.

Tracks assigned and completed work via paper and digital means. Utilizes computer-based programs to report work order status, time spent on task, and necessary follow-up. Frequently engages with flight level leaders to ensure completion of tasks associated with inspections and regulatory requirements. Completes inventories of maintenance equipment and reports needs to program directors for acquisition.

Receives and inspects shipments to ensure proper pickup and delivery of orders. Properly stores and transports a broad range of materials and items, to include universal waste. Pick-up and distribute official mail for 11 programs.

Qualifying Experience:
Must speak, read and write English. Must have experience which demonstrates knowledge of and skill in operating buses capable of carrying 16 or more passengers; traffic and safety regulations, practices and procedures pertaining to motor vehicle operation (buses); and passenger safety rules. In addition, must have experience which demonstrates the ability to: communicate orally; be courteous; judge road/traffic conditions and read maps to determine the shortest and safest route; interpret instructions, specifications related to motor vehicle operation (buses); perform preventive maintenance requirements, diagnose minor maintenance needs, and ensure passenger safety. Must have experience which demonstrated the ability to operate, control and clean heavy powered equipment. Requires reaching, turning or moving hands, arms, feet and legs; associated duties require stooping, bending and climbing. Completion of CPR and First Aid training is desirable.
